LOGNAME(1,C) AIX Commands Reference LOGNAME(1,C) ------------------------------------------------------------------------------- logname PURPOSE Displays your login name. SYNTAX logname ---| Warning: See restrictions, Chapter 18, AIX Programming Tools and Interfaces. DESCRIPTION The logname command writes to standard output the name you used to log into the system. The command is the contents of the environment variable $LOGNAME, which is set when you log into the system. RELATED INFORMATION See the following commands: "env, printenv" and "login."
